Introduction Articulation Index was developed by the Linguistic Data Consortium (LDC) and was partly inspired by the work of Harvey Fletcher, who performed a number of perceptual experiments involving English syllables during the first half of the 20th century. His term articulation index meant something like perceptual index of syllables, where those syllables were not necessarily words, and reflected how well speakers could correctly identify syllables in the presence of noise. This corpus was created to facilitate similar experiments, as well as to potentially facilitate new methods in speech recognition research. The basic concept behind the corpus was to record speakers pronouncing syllables of English, some of which might be real words, but most of which are nonsense syllables. The goal was to have each speaker say a set of 2,000 syllables common to all speakers, as well as a set of 20 syllables unique to that speaker. LDC has also released Articulation Index LSCP (LDC2015S12) Data This release contains recordings of 20 American English speakers (12 males, 8 females) saying 2005 common syllables, 1845 of which are common to all speakers, and 400 unique syllables (20 syllables/ speaker). The recordings were made in small, sound-treated anechoic room at LDC. The speakers wore two microphones: a Sennheiser 410 headset and a Nortel Liberator wireless phone headset. The Sennheiser's signal traveled through a Symetrix 302 Dual Microphone Preamp, Sony PCM-R300 DAT deck and Townshend Datlink to a Sun Sparcserver 20 where it was written to disk at 16 KHz, 16-bit, pcm data. The Nortel's signal was transmitted to a wireless base station at a telephone connected via the network to LDC's telephone recording platform where it was caputred to disk as 8 KHz, 8-bit, u-law data. The speakers were prompted via a computer interface that displayed one prompt at a time, allowing them to iterate through the prompts by pressing a "next" button. ## 引言 清晰度指数(Articulation Index)由语言数据联盟(LDC)开发,其研发部分灵感源自哈维·弗莱彻的研究工作。弗莱彻于20世纪上半叶开展了多项涉及英语音节的感知实验,其提出的“清晰度指数”大致意为“音节感知指数”——此处的音节未必为完整单词,该指数反映的是说话者在噪声环境下正确识别音节的能力。 本语料库的构建旨在助力同类实验,同时有望为语音识别研究中的新方法开发提供支撑。该语料库的核心设计思路为录制说话者朗读英语音节的音频:其中部分音节可为真实单词,但绝大多数为无意义音节。其设计目标为,每位说话者需朗读两组音节:一组为所有说话者共享的2000个通用音节,另一组为该说话者独有的20个专属音节。 语言数据联盟还发布了清晰度指数LSCP(LDC2015S12)数据集。本次发布包含20位美式英语母语者(12名男性、8名女性)的朗读录音:共录制2005个通用音节,其中1845个为所有说话者共享,另有400个专属音节(每位说话者对应20个专属音节)。 录音均在语言数据联盟的小型隔音消声室内完成。每位说话者佩戴两支麦克风:分别为森海塞尔(Sennheiser)410头戴式麦克风,以及北电(Nortel)Liberator无线电话头戴耳机。森海塞尔麦克风的信号依次经过Symetrix 302双麦克风前置放大器、索尼(Sony)PCM-R300 DAT录音机以及Townshend Datlink设备,最终传输至Sun Sparcserver 20服务器,以16 kHz、16位脉冲编码调制(PCM)数据格式写入磁盘。北电麦克风的信号被传输至电话端的无线基站,该基站通过网络连接至语言数据联盟的电话录音平台,最终以8 kHz、8位μ律(u-law)数据格式写入磁盘。 说话者通过计算机界面获取朗读提示:界面每次仅显示一条提示,说话者可通过按下"next"按钮依次浏览所有提示项。单次录音时长约为15分钟。 ## 样本 若需查看本语料库的示例,请参阅该音频样本。 © 2005 宾夕法尼亚大学托管委员会
